You'll be responsible for

📞

Liaising with partners and stakeholders

Engaging with partners, stakeholders, and associations to fulfill contractual agreements and ensure smooth operations.
🔍

Analyzing partnership performance

Tracking and assessing the return on investment for partnership benefits to optimize outcomes.
👥

Overseeing team members

Supporting and guiding two Partnership & Event Specialists in managing their portfolios effectively.
